  • 简介

    The ICAM-1/CD54 protein is a ligand of the leukocyte adhesion protein LFA-1 and is critical for leukocyte transendothelial migration. Its involvement activates ARHGEF26/SGEF and RHOG, coordinating endothelial apical cup assembly. ICAM-1/CD54 Protein, Rhesus Macaque (HEK293, Fc) is the recombinant Rhesus Macaque-derived ICAM-1/CD54 protein, expressed by HEK293 , with C-hFc labeled tag.

  • Biological Activity

    Measured by its binding ability in a functional ELISA. Immobilized Recombinant Human ITGAL&ITGB2 Heterodimer is immobilized at 10 µg/mL (100 µL/well) can bind Biotinylated Rhesus Macaque ICAM-1. The ED50 for this effect is 1.539 ng/mL. Measured by its binding ability in a functional ELISA.   • Stability Test

    The thermal stability is described by the loss rate. The loss rate was determined by accelerated thermal degradation test, that is, incubate the protein at 37℃ for 48h, and no obvious degradation and precipitation were observed. The loss rate isless than 8% within the expiration date under appropriate storage condition.

Protein Description

ICAM-1 (Intercellular Adhesion Molecule-1), also known as CD54, is a crucial adhesion molecule expressed on endothelial cells and immune cells, playing a significant role in inflammation and immune response. Its primary function is to facilitate the binding of leukocytes to endothelial cells, which is critical during immune responses and the migration of immune cells to sites of inflammation. Dysregulation of ICAM-1 can result in various pathological conditions, including chronic inflammation, autoimmune diseases, and tumor progression.
